SUPPLEMENT FOR LIVESTOCK
A product and method of parasitic control, ammonia control, methane inhibition, liver abscess inhibition, and nutritional supplementation in livestock in order to grow healthier and more efficient livestock. The supplement is designed to provide an antibiotic-free and antiparasitic-free feed additive to decrease parasites, inhibit methane production, and ammonia production in livestock, inhibit the incidence of liver abscesses while providing a nutritional supplement to livestock and simultaneously providing for increased weight gain and overall positive health in the same.

Methods and formulations for reducing bovine emissions
The present disclosure provides methods and formulations for reducing ammonia and carbon dioxide emissions from a bovine using lubabegron, or a physiologically acceptable salt thereof. The present disclosure also provides bovine feed additives and bovine feed compositions.

Methods for modulating taste receptors
Amino acids present in domains of an umami taste receptor are described herein, wherein the amino acids interact with at least one nucleotide derivative and/or at least one transmembrane compound that potentiates, modulates, increases, and/or enhances the activity of the umami receptor. Such compounds can be used in flavor compositions to enhance the umami taste and/or palatability of food products.
